I currently run a pile of different pieces of software. SkyX as planetarium and goto for my mount (a Tak EM200), Maxim DL for controlling cameras and guiding (STF8300 with OAG), Focus Max for focussing. I operate off a mobile system with tripod so different orientation of camera and slightly different polar alignment each set up.
My wish list looks like this
- be able to drop back perfectly on to the same image point after moving away to refocus during the same evening.
- image the same object over several nights with the same positioning although I accept without a rotator this may not be perfect.
- at some stage in the future more automation of imaging sessions.
I have not yet explored plate solving and I assume that has to appear in the equation somewhere. I have also seen references to software like CCD Autopilot.
Appreciate suggestions on the next steps.

If you have TheSkyX Pro, it will do all of those things. You won't need Maxim nor FocusMax. CCDAutopilot will automate the session when you need to. CCDCommander doesn't work with TheSkyX.

To achieve automation you will need to find a mount with homing sensors.

However, generally, pinpoint is used for plate solving, MaximDL or any similar camera control for camera and guiding. The planetarium you are using is fine. Focusing through focusmax is good too. Rotator is really only needed for changing the angle of your images and for crossing the meridian (ie flipping the mount).
